Under the supervision of a higher-level manager and the Park Admin team, the Recreation Complex Manager 1 supervises Athletics closing programs and operations within Denny Farrell Riverbank State Park. The incumbent performs the following duties: Identifies community recreational needs and works with the community, school groups and local government officials to develop and implement programs, schedules, and special events; assigns staff, prepares schedules, supervises and evaluates the effectiveness of contractors and subordinate delivery of programs; inspects, evaluates and assures the readiness and availability of equipment and facilities to meet requirements for scheduled activities; supervises recreation and administrative staff and participates in recruitment and training programs; covers scheduled Officer of the day shifts as needed, inspects cleaning and maintenance tasks performed by staff; develops and implements cleaning and routine maintenance schedules for complex staff; in conjunction with the maintenance supervisors, plans major repair and preventative projects; assists higher level managers to plan and budget for equipment, repairs and supplies needed to support existing and planned programming & events; orders needed supplies and materials; requests needed repairs and ongoing maintenance and coordinates them to minimize adverse impact on customer services; makes recommendations to higher level management for policies, procedures, training and facility improvements to enhance the customer experience and promote customer satisfaction; assures that all Agency, Regional and Park standards for service delivery, customer service and employee conduct and performance are consistently met; carries out other related duties and responsibilities as assigned; may also serve as shift supervisor for all programs and operations.

Minimum Qualifications:
Six years of experience, including 1 year of supervisory experience, directing an athletic, sports or recreation facility or program. OR a bachelor's degree in any field and two years of the general experience, including one year of supervisory experience. Substitution- A master's degree in park administration, recreation, physical education, fine arts, or a closely related field may substitute for one year of the required experience. *If verifiable, we will accept and prorate appropriate part-time and volunteer experience.
